Key Responsibilities
- Review construction documents at all phases (conceptual schematic and final) to produce detailed quantity and cost estimates particularly for concrete and steel scopes.
- Maintain comprehensive and wellorganized project records and documentation.
- Prepare thorough and accurate construction progress meeting minutes.
- Evaluate cost estimates prepared by design consultants and provide feedback or corrections.
- Conduct field visits as needed to ensure alignment with plans specifications and project goals.
- Assist in preparing engineering reports technical documentation and supporting drawings.
- Review contractor submittals and shop drawings for compliance with project specifications.
- Remain current with industry regulations standards and best practices.
- Participate in both internal team meetings and clientfacing meetings to discuss project status and resolve any challenges.
- Prepare change orders material testing reports and other projectrelated documentation.
- Demonstrate strong knowledge of recordkeeping and documentation systems in a construction environment.
